Summary of use and Rights-Managed End User License Agreement:

  1. HomeSpot Media owns the photos we take. When you hire HomeSpot Media to take photos of a real estate listing what you are paying for is a temporary LICENSE for one specific person (you) to USE those photos for a specific purpose (advertise your listing) for a specific length of time (the duration of your listing).
  2. Your MLS may claim that by uploading listing photos to the MLS site you (the agent) transfer ownership or copyright of the photos to the MLS. Court cases have shown this to be false. You (the agent) cannot transfer the copyright because you do not own the copyright. Each of our photos is watermarked with the HomeSpot Media logo as proof of copyright. Said copyright can only be transferred by HomeSpot Media, Inc.
  3. Unauthorized use of photos or video content will be considered willfully infringing HomeSpot Media, Inc.’s rights under 17 U.S.C. Section 101 et seq. and he offending person or party using photos or video content without permission, for purposes of commercial advantage and/or private financial gain, could be liable for statutory damages as high as $150,000 as set forth in Section 504(c)(2)
